#90efb1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#90efb1 is composed of 56.5% red, 93.7%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 140.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 75.1%. #90efb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#21df63.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#90efb1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#90efb1 has RGB values of R:144, G:239,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 9498545.

Hex triplet 90efb1 #90efb1
RGB Decimal 144, 239, 177 rgb(144,239,177)
RGB Percent 56.5, 93.7, 69.4 rgb(56.5%,93.7%,69.4%)
CMYK 40, 0, 26, 6
HSL 140.8°, 74.8, 75.1 hsl(140.8,74.8%,75.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 140.8°, 39.7, 93.7
Web Safe 99ff99 #99ff99
CIE-LAB 87.404, -41.272, 21.339
XYZ 50.301, 70.834, 52.614
xyY 0.29, 0.408, 70.834
CIE-LCH 87.404, 46.462, 152.659
CIE-LUV 87.404, -44.873, 37.926
Hunter-Lab 84.163, -40.602, 21.849
Binary 10010000, 11101111, 10110001

Shades and Tints of #90efb1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010904 is the darkest color, while #f7f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#90efb1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cc3be is the less saturated color, while #81fead is the most saturated one.
